About

Gunaseelan Rajan is a scholar working on Oral Surgery, Surgery and Orthodontics. According to data from OpenAlex, Gunaseelan Rajan has authored 26 papers receiving a total of 288 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 19 papers in Oral Surgery, 6 papers in Surgery and 5 papers in Orthodontics. Recurrent topics in Gunaseelan Rajan's work include Dental Implant Techniques and Outcomes (13 papers), Oral and Maxillofacial Pathology (6 papers) and Dental materials and restorations (5 papers). Gunaseelan Rajan is often cited by papers focused on Dental Implant Techniques and Outcomes (13 papers), Oral and Maxillofacial Pathology (6 papers) and Dental materials and restorations (5 papers). Gunaseelan Rajan collaborates with scholars based in India, Malaysia and Hong Kong. Gunaseelan Rajan's co-authors include Anantanarayanan Parameswaran, Mirza Rustum Baig, Lim Kwong Cheung, Jojo Kottoor, Jogikalmat Krithikadatta, Sowmya Ramesh, Kannan Ranganathan, Saravana Kumar, Lakshman P. Samaranayake and Saseendar Shanmugasundaram and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Endodontics, Journal of Prosthetic Dentistry and Journal of Oral and Maxillofacial Surgery.
